 | Montreuil
is a fascinating walled, hilltop town with charming buildings, thriving shops
and splendid bars and restaurants. It's just beyond Boulogne, 10 minutes from
Le Touquet and it's a short drive time from Calais, so it makes it ideal for an
overnight taste of France. The Chateau atop the town and set on it's defensive
ramparts was the headquarters of General Haig in the first World War. The surrounding
countryside and nearby coast are lovely. | Jon
